Limited Site Investigation Irerracon <br /> Proposed Love's Travel Stop a Lodi, California <br /> April 15, 2011 ■ Terracon Project No. 60117009 <br /> 3.0 LABORATORY ANALYTICAL METHODS <br /> The soil and groundwater samples collected from the borings were analyzed for BTEX, MTBE <br /> by United States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) Method 8260B, and for TPH by EPA <br /> Method 8015M. In addition, one field blank was prepared and analyzed for BTEX and MTBE by <br /> EPA Method 8260B for quality control (QC) purposes. <br /> Laboratory soil and groundwater results are summarized in Tables 1 and 2, respectively, and <br /> included in Appendix C. The laboratory data sheets and executed chain-of-custody form are <br /> provided in Appendix D. <br /> 4.0 DATA EVALUATION <br /> 4.1 Soil Samples <br /> The soil samples collected from borings B-1 OA, B-11A, and B-1 2A did not exhibit BTEX, MTBE, <br /> and TPH concentrations above the laboratory method reporting limits. A summary of the results <br /> are presented in Table 1 of Appendix C. <br /> The site is located within the jurisdiction of the San Joaquin County Environmental Health <br /> Department, Region 5 of the Regional Water Quality Control Board (RWQCB) - Central Valley <br /> Region, and EPA Region 9. Applicable screening levels for soil concentrations for BTEX, <br /> MTBE, and TPH have not been established by either of these regions. After discussions with <br /> Mr. Clay Rogers from RWQCB from the Central Valley Region, Terracon was advised to <br /> compare the results of the soil investigation to Region 4 of the RWQCB — Los Angeles Region, <br /> maximum screening levels (MSLs). The soil samples obtained during this LSI, reported <br /> laboratory detection limits below applicable MSI-s. <br /> 4.2 Groundwater Samples <br /> The groundwater samples collected from borings B-10A (TSP-10A), B-11A (TSP-11A), and B- <br /> 12A (TSP-12A) did not exhibit BTEX, MTBE, and TPH concentrations above the laboratory <br /> method reporting limits, except for TPH diesel range (TPH DRO) for TSP-10A reported at a low <br /> concentration of 0.229 milligrams per liter (mg/L). A summary of the results are presented in <br /> Table 2 of Appendix C. <br /> In accordance with the Basin Plan for the Sacramento River and San Joaquin River Basins, <br /> dated September 15, 1998, the beneficial use for groundwater in Lodi has been designated for <br /> Municipal and Domestic supply, agricultural supply, industrial service supply, and groundwater <br /> recharge supply.
